 Happy Birthday, Electric Guitar
Happy Birthday, Electric Guitar
The Gibson electric guitar was patented in the United States seventy-two years ago today. The first electric guitars were developed by the mid-30s in response to the needs of guitarists in jazz orchestras to produce more volume. These were played flat on the lap and became popular with Hawaiian bands.  First custom electric American chopper
First custom electric American chopper
Siemens, the electronics and electrical engineering global powerhouse, unveiled the Smart Chopper it commissioned. The bike has a 60-mile range and a 100 mph top speed. An onboard charging unit can be plugged into any 110-volt socket to charge the bike in five hours, and it’ll charge in as little as one hour when plugged into a higher-voltage station.
